.Sh NAME
.Nm hash ,
.Nm hash32_buf ,
.Nm hash32_str ,
.Nm hash32_strn
.Nd kernel hash functions
.Sh SYNOPSIS
.In sys/types.h
.In sys/hash.h
.Ft uint32_t
.Fn hash32_buf "const void *buf" "size_t len" "uint32_t ihash"
.Ft uint32_t
.Fn hash32_str "const void *buf" "uint32_t ihash"
.Ft uint32_t
.Fn hash32_strn "const void *buf" "size_t len" "uint32_t ihash"
.Sh DESCRIPTION
The
.Nm
functions returns a hash of the given buffer.
.Pp
The
.Fn hash32_buf
function returns a 32 bit hash of
.Fa buf ,
which is
.Fa len
bytes long,
seeded with an initial hash of
.Fa ihash
(which is usually
.Dv HASH32_BUF_INIT ) .
This function may use a different algorithm to
.Fn hash32_str
and
.Fn hash32_strn .
.Pp
The
.Fn hash32_str
function returns a 32 bit hash of
.Fa buf ,
which is
a
.Dv NUL
terminated
.Tn ASCII
string,
seeded with an initial hash of
.Fa ihash
(which is usually
.Dv HASH32_STR_INIT ) .
This function must use the same algorithm as
.Fn hash32_strn ,
so that the same data returns the same hash.
.Pp
The
.Fn hash32_strn
function returns a 32 bit hash of
.Fa buf ,
which is
a
.Dv NUL
terminated
.Tn ASCII
string,
up to a maximum of
.Fa len
bytes,
seeded with an initial hash of
.Fa ihash
(which is usually
.Dv HASH32_STR_INIT ) .
This function must use the same algorithm as
.Fn hash32_str ,
so that the same data returns the same hash.
.Pp
The
.Fa ihash
parameter is provided to allow for incremental hashing by allowing
successive calls to use a previous hash value.
.Sh RETURN VALUES
The
.Fa hash32_*
functions return a 32 bit hash of the provided buffer.
.Sh HISTORY
The kernel hashing API first appeared in
.Nx 1.6 .
